Rose Hip Crumble Pie
- 1 9 inch pie shell
- 1 cup dried rose hips
- 1/4 cup milk
- 1 1/2 cups sifted flour
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1 dash salt
- 1/2 cup shortening
- 1 3/4 cups brown sugar
- 2 egg yolks, beaten
- 2 egg whites
- pecan halves (optional)
- 1. Prepare pastry and line a pie pan.
- 2. Soften rose hips in milk.
- 3. Sift together flour, baking powder, and salt. Cream in shortening and brown sugar, mixing well. This makes a crumbly mixture--reserve one cup for topping. To the remainder add the egg yolks and rose hips.
- 4. Beat the egg whites until peaks form. Fold into the berry mixture.
- 5. Spoon into pie pan and sprinkle with crumbly topping. Garnish with pecans if desired.
- 5. Bake at 350 degrees for 35 to 45 minutes.
